Christian Rosa was born in 1982 in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. Rosa studied under Daniel Richter at the Akademie der Bildenden Kunste in Vienna, where he graduated in 2012. The artist lives in Vienna but spends the majority of his time in Los Angeles painting and organising exhibitions, film screenings and publications.
In 2014, Rosa participated in Art Basel Hong Kong, at Art Los Angeles Contemporary and at the Armory Show with Ibid, with whom he featured his first solo show. 2013 was also a pivotal year for the artist: with highlights ranging from his participation in ReMap4 in Athens to his presentation at Freize. He has also exhibited at the Venice and Vienna Biennale as well as at Greene Naftali in New York, at Brand New Gallery in Milan and with White Cube. The artist was included in the 2014 ‘Artists to Watch’ exhibition and the M building in Miami earlier this year.
Employing various mediums including oil paint, spray paint and pencil, Rosa combines colour, line and form to create impulsive, captivating works. His abstract images present the results of chance and progression in an energetic, animated reflection of the creative process. Subtle planes, primary colours and gestural brushstrokes allude to various notions yet find beauty in mystery and enigma. The works encourage the viewer to question their own perception and to interact with the canvas in a similar manner to the interrelating elements within the composition. In their improvisational, almost fleeting quality, the paintings remain fresh and unassuming. By decreasing density of composition, reducing colour palette and lightening line depiction, Rosa presents a cohesive, appealing almost hypnotising work in its uniquely commandeering simplicity.
